Accept Recognitions:

Some of your fans (who have the means) will want to recognize your outstanding work by sending you a paid recognition as a way to acknowledge the individual contribution you made to their experience at the show.

You can choose to accept this recognition for:

  • your own artistic endeavors

  • pass it along to your favorite charity or cause

  • or both.

When you opt-in to receive these recognitions, you can create a short statement about where you plan to use the recognition.

5% of the recognition automatically goes to charity, but if you choose to send an additional amount to a charity of your choice, you have the flexibility to do so. 

How does it work?

  • 5% goes automatically to charity:
    The Stage Door Foundation supports theatre makers and the development of new works by providing subsidized studio space and financial support to develop new works in the creative pipeline. Learn more.

    10% of the recognition goes to your production:
    The production, which features your work receives 10%.

    70% of the recognition goes to you:
    Use for your artistic endeavors or you can pass along to your favorite charity. 

    The remainder goes to support the Stage Door Network system to help facilitate the system. 

  • All transactions are handled securely through your Stripe account, which inegrates to our system. When recognitions are sent, the money is credited to your Stripe account, paid out each month.

  • The full amount of the recognition goes to your Stripe account and from there you decide how and when to send the donations to your charity. Stage Door Pass does not automate those payments.
